I got my autonomous desk today. I got the black extra large desktop with the dual motor setup. Haven't gotten all the parts to put together the computer or even moved my chair in yet, so I can only give my initial impressions. Boxes came very well packed. The cardboard was beat to hell on the outside but all the parts were in perfect condition. It was very easy to put together with clear instructions. Only took about 15 minutes (helps to have an allen bit for your power drill). The frame, motor, and desktop are very solid and well made. Everything seems high quality and looks good. The dual motors are very smooth and not too loud. The only weird thing is the desk grommets that come with the desk are kinds crappy and cheap, doesn't really fit with the rest of the desk.
